It's a bittersweet day at Keeper's Cottage.

Outside Keeper's Cottage Eddie agrees with Alan he'll start work on his patio next week. Will calls round.

Inside, Joe and Ed look through Ed's business plan. Joe says Ed having a herd of his own is worth every penny. Eddie and Will come in for coffee. Will offers grudging congratulations about the tenancy as Ed goes off to milk. Will tells Joe and Eddie that Adam's finally put in the game crops. And Jake's now at Loxley Barratt school. Joe says everything's looking up for the Grundys. Then the phone rings. It's Mildred's son.

At Grange Farm Oliver tells Ed he's happy with the business plan. He'll ask his solicitor to draw up an agreement. They should celebrate.

Joe's telling Eddie that Mildred's died when Ed and Oliver arrive with champagne. Oliver makes a speech about how proud he is of Ed. Joe quietly goes outside. Ed follows him, and realises what's happened. Joe tells him to carry on. Hes off for a walk. Ed goes back inside, and they drink to seizing the day.

Alan meets Joe in the churchyard. Joe tells Alan about a picnic he had there with Mildred. Alan says Joe must miss her, as she's so far away. Joe says he treasures his memories.

Episode written by Tim Stimpson.
